Have you begun participating in the Grocery Card Program yet? If not, you are letting free money for the school pass us by every time you shop for groceries!
There is an easy, no extra cost to you, way to support our school on a regular basis – grocery cards! Compass participates in an on-going program with King Soopers, Safeway and Sunflower Market to raise money for the school without costing our families any extra money on their groceries.
Drop off your order form to either campus office by Monday morning and you will receive your grocery card(s) by the end of the week. For example, if you purchase a $100 card to Kings, Safeway or Sunflower, you will be able to redeem the card for the full $100, but Compass will receive a rebate of between 3% - 5% back from the store. (The Kings and Safeway cards can also be used at their in-store pharmacies or to purchase gas.) Easy and win-win!
We can accept cash, check or credit cards for payment. If you can write a check or use cash, it saves Compass the additional credit card processing fee.

I am so excited to invite you to come listen to Pat Schaeffer for our parent information night on Wednesday, February 10th at 6:30 at the Wheat Ridge Campus.
The topic is Literacy as it Applies to the Four Planes of Development.
Pat Schaeffer is a nationally recognized Montessori consultant and educator. She has taught Montessori education for over 30 years and was the founder of Lake County Montessori School in Minneapolis, MN.
Pat is our Literacy Consultant and has been helping us with our year long literacy project where we are working to create a cohesive pre-k through 12th grade Montessori approach to literacy. She will be here that Wednesday, Thursday and Friday working with staff as we continue to evolve literacy education at Compass.
This parent information night will be a wonderful opportunity for you to better understand the Montessori method whether your student is in Children's House, Elementary, Farm School or High School. Many of our parents chose Compass because of its great reputation but still are a little confused regarding why we do things the way we do. Pat will provide to you a deeper understanding of Montessori education, the four planes of development, and the Montessori approach to literacy. She will also create time to answer questions.

The name for this years’ Spring fundraising event is the First Annual Compass Showcase and Silent Auction. This years’ free event will be held at the Golden Campus, starting the night with the silent auction and hors d’oeuvres. Entertainment will be provided by Compass community members while the silent auction is going on.
After the close of the silent auction, everyone will move down to the auditorium for dessert and the First Annual Compass Showcase ( similar to American Idol but more family member participants ) we will have judges but it will not be a competition, just a chance for us to appreciate the talent in our ever expanding community. This will last for about an hour while the silent auction items are tallied.
Come one come all, we encourage family acts. Music, magic, comedy or what-ever you do to entertain. All acts will be reviewed prior to the showcase. After the showcase you can go and retrieve your auction items and check out.
The goal is to have people spend their money at the silent auction rather than on the dinner.
